Tom Morello’s New Single, ‘Lucky One’ ft. K.Flay is a Reckoning

Rate the music. Hot or not?

Tom Morello’s upcoming solo album The Atlas Underground, out October 12, comes in a political climate overwhelmed, again, by the same urgency that inspired the radical leftist politics behind his band Rage Against The Machine. With people finally catching up, Morello is aspiring to create the sounds of the future with his new album. It includes collaborations with Vic Mensa, Big Boi, Killer Mike, Portugal. The Man, Gary Clark Junior, Steve Aoki, and many more.

Today, Morello has shared “Lucky One,” a new track harkening back to the days of Rage, with the exception of the celestial vocals from K. Flay, a likeminded rapper, and rock musician. Watch a behind-the-scenes video featuring the two artists discuss how privilege, and their own experiences with it, informed the song’s direction.
